It ships with (an old version of) OpenWRT preinstalled. It doesn't get better/friendlier than that
Add a nice case (for instance from netgate.com - they have them but the page for that product seems to be broken right now, sigh) and powersupply (48V DC, netgate has them too).
Finally, add up to three minipci wifi cards (and make sure to get pigtails and antennas). A good vendor for that stuff is pcengines.ch; the Wistron DNMA92 Atheros 802.11a/b/g/n card is cheap at $26 and it uses the ath9k driver (no binary blobs). PCengines also has cheap pigtails and antennas.
All in all this costs quite a bit more than your run of the mill access point, but this puppy is a lot more powerful than your average access point.
